Philip Billing struck one of the fastest goals in Premier League history when AFC Bournemouth opened the scoring after just nine seconds against Arsenal

The Cherries broke down the right side right from kick-off and stunned the Emirates Stadium crowd with a cross from Dango Ouattara that caught out the Arsenal defence for Billing to apply a simple finish.

Opta, the Premier League's official data supplier, timed the goal at 9.11 seconds. 

That makes it the second-fastest goal in Premier League history. It is over a second more than Shane Long's goal on 23 April 2019 for Southampton at Watford. That was timed at only 7.69 seconds from kick-off. 

It goes into the No 2 slot ahead of the goal that defender Ledley King scored after 9.82 seconds for Tottenham Hotspur at Bradford City in the 2000/01 season. 

Interestingly, eight of the 10 fastest goals have been scored by the away team. 

Top 10 fastest Premier League goals
Time (sec) Player Match Season
07.69 Shane Long Watford v Southampton 2018/19
09.11 Philip Billing Arsenal v AFC Bournemouth 2022/23
09.82 Ledley King Bradford City v Spurs 2000/01
10.52 Alan Shearer Newcastle v Man City 2002/03
10.54 Christian Eriksen Spurs v Man Utd 2017/18
11.90 Mark Viduka Charlton v Leeds 2000/01
12.16 Dwight Yorke Coventry v Aston Villa 1995/96
12.94 Chris Sutton Everton v Blackburn 1994/95
13.48 Kevin Nolan Blackburn v Bolton 2003/04
13.52 James Beattie Chelsea v Southampton 2004/05
